SALUTING OUR HEROES: Salt Lake City Luncheon
|
| |
Date: November 15, 2011
Location: Rice Eccles, Salt Lake City
Time: 12:00PM - 1:30PM
Join Utah Governor, Gary Herbert as well as current and retired members of our Armed Forces as we salute those who have served our country and those injured in service.
As the number of Wounded Warriors created out of U.S. military conflicts continues to rise (over 60,000 from 2001), existing support services are being strained by the requirements of this growing population. Fortunately, there are public and private partnerships across the country who are working together to address the needs of our returning servicemen and women.
Collectively, we enable injured members of the Armed Services to heal their minds, bodies and spirits and return home to their families and communities ready to meet life's greater challenges. We hope you can join us!

DEL TACO GIVING CAMPAIGN: November
|
| |
|

For the second year in row, Paul and Jane Hitzelberger, owners of Del Taco franchisee Utah Del Inc., and their incredible team will host a month of giving to benefit National Ability Center children, soldiers, veterans and their families in Utah.
Beginning November 3rd and through November 29th the Utah restaurant chain will hold the promotion in their 24 stores statewide. Throughout the promotion Del Taco customers are invited to make donations of $1 and more to benefit children and adults with disabilities and their family members. One hundred percent of your donation will go to directly support NAC participants and programs.
